We have found a strange thing in the user profile. There are two users Sam and Ram. Sam is the manager to Ram, so Ram reports to Sam. When we check Sam's profile, normally under organization the user's who reports to sam will be visible under his profile.

But if we check, Ram profile is not visible under Sam's profile. And aslo, if we search user profile in teams it will give the search results of profile cards. But in this case when we search for Ram's profile in teams it is not visible, even if we enter the mail id or user name the search results is empty. It will only show, if we put email id/ name and press enter and click the people filter, then ram profile will be visible.

This is the strange behavior that we have noted. We have also checked in on-prem AD by comparing other user profile with Ram's profile by each and every properties. But no difference is found.

Please let us know what the is the issue behind this?

    Here are a few possibilities that might be causing this issue:

    1.Teams Cache: Microsoft Teams client has a local cache that stores user profile information. If this cache is not updated or is corrupted, it might not show the latest information.

    Please try clearing the cache and updating Teams to the latest version.

    User's image

    2.Sync Issue: There might be a synchronization issue between your on-premises Active Directory (AD) and Azure AD. There might be a mismatch in the attributes of Ram’s profile in the on-premises AD and Azure AD.

    Please check in Azure AD that the user is correctly configured and in M365 admin center that the user has been assigned a manager.
